    Abstract: A clothes treatment apparatus includes a cabinet, a door, and a steam unit. The clothes treatment apparatus further includes a heat pump unit that is located in the cycle chamber and that is configured to circulate and condition air in the treatment chamber. The clothes treatment apparatus further includes a water supply tank that is installed in the tank installation space, that is connected to the steam unit, and that is configured to supply water to the steam unit. The clothes treatment apparatus further includes a drainage tank that is separably installed in the tank installation space, that is configured to store condensed water generated in at least one of the treatment chamber or the heat pump unit. The clothes treatment apparatus further includes a water supply level sensor. The clothes treatment apparatus further includes a drainage level sensor.

    Abstract: A washing machine includes a cabinet, a door, a tub provided within the cabinet, a wireless communication module provided within the cabinet, and a controller in operative communication with the wireless communication module. The controller is configured to perform a series of operations, including receiving an initiation signal for a laundry operation to be performed by the washing machine appliance; sending a wake-up signal to a mobile electronic device via the wireless communication module in response to receiving the initiation signal; emitting a laundry operation trigger prior to initiating the laundry operation; determining that the mobile device is within a predetermined distance from the washing machine appliance in response to generating the laundry operation trigger; and receiving a confirmation signal before beginning the laundry operation.

    Abstract: A vehicle-mounted sensor cleaning device cleans a sensing surface of a vehicle-mounted sensor. The vehicle-mounted sensor cleaning device includes a gas nozzle spraying a gas toward the sensing surface, a gas supply device supplying the gas to the gas nozzle, and a control section controlling operation of the gas supply device. A predetermined value is set in the control section, for indicating an abnormal state of detection accuracy of the vehicle-mounted sensor based on detection accuracy information of an object which is obtained from the vehicle-mounted sensor. A gas supply threshold value is also set, for use in operating the gas supply device to direct a supply of the gas toward the sensing surface before the detection accuracy information becomes equal to or lower than the predetermined value. If the detection accuracy information has become lower than the gas supply threshold value, the control section operates the gas supply device.

    Abstract: A sliding-pivoting mechanism of a shelf of a piece of furniture or household appliance includes two pivot arms pivotally secured to a body and forming a parallel guide for a pull-out guide having at least one guide rail and a running rail. A locking mechanism is arranged on the guide rail and on one of the pivot arms for preventing a simultaneous pivoting and sliding movement. The locking mechanism has a locking pin moveably arranged on one of the pivot arms, and a locking plate mounted stationarily relative to the guide rail and with which the locking pin cooperates in such a way that a pivoting of the pivot arm is blocked when the shelf is raised into an upper loading and unloading position. An unlocking device is coupled to the locking mechanism and includes an actuation element and an unlocking element, with which the locking pin can be moved out of a blocking position into a release position.

    Abstract: This vehicle cleaner unit is provided with: a cylinder unit comprising a cylinder which forms a chamber, a discharge port through which the chamber opens to the outside, and a piston which reciprocates inside of the cylinder and discharges from the discharge port a cleaning medium inside of the chamber; a power unit comprising a motor, a power transmission mechanism which transmits rotary motion of the motor to the piston to cause the piston to reciprocate, and a housing which houses the motor and the power transmission mechanism; and a casing which houses the cylinder unit and the power unit. The cylinder unit and the power unit are supported by the casing with rubber members interposed therebetween.
